Types of Commercial Projects

Retail properties need attractive, durable concrete that handles customer traffic and looks professional. We install decorative concrete entrances, sidewalks, and plaza areas that enhance your business appearance.

Industrial facilities require heavy-duty concrete built for forklifts, trucks, and machinery. Loading docks must handle repeated impacts from equipment. Warehouse floors need special finishes that resist wear and provide level surfaces for material handling equipment.

Office buildings need reliable foundations, parking areas, and pedestrian walkways. These projects require coordination with architects, engineers, and other contractors to stay on schedule.

Property managers call us for repairs and upgrades to existing concrete. Trip hazards, cracked parking lots, and deteriorating sidewalks create liability issues. We handle repairs quickly to keep your property safe and attractive.

Quality Materials and Workmanship

Commercial concrete needs higher strength mixes and proper reinforcement. We use commercial-grade materials specified for your project requirements. Steel reinforcement, fiber additives, and specialty admixtures create concrete that performs under demanding conditions.

Quality control matters more on commercial projects because failures affect business operations. We test concrete strength, maintain proper curing conditions, and follow engineering specifications exactly. This attention to detail prevents problems that show up later.
